What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— spent $570,226 more than it took in. Revenue $1,209,788 · expenses $1,780,014 · reserve months 52.1
Tax year 2022 — spent $973,924 more than it took in. Revenue $514,877 · expenses $1,488,801 · reserve months 60.3
Tax year 2020 — took in $120,887 more than it spent. Revenue $1,280,520 · expenses $1,159,633 · reserve months 71.4
Tax year 2019 — took in $282,674 more than it spent. Revenue $1,256,365 · expenses $973,691 · reserve months 83.6
Tax year 2018 — took in $135,621 more than it spent. Revenue $1,043,621 · expenses $908,000 · reserve months 85.9
Tax year 2017 — took in $578,910 more than it spent. Revenue $1,355,891 · expenses $776,981 · reserve months 98.3
Tax year 2016 — took in $1,093,827 more than it spent. Revenue $1,927,507 · expenses $833,680 · reserve months 83.2
Tax year 2015 — took in $266,547 more than it spent. Revenue $1,194,919 · expenses $928,372 · reserve months 60.6
Tax year 2014 — took in $438,996 more than it spent. Revenue $1,575,203 · expenses $1,136,207 · reserve months 46.7
Tax year 2013 — took in $436,618 more than it spent. Revenue $1,206,748 · expenses $770,130 · reserve months 62.1
Tax year 2012 — spent $22,913 more than it took in. Revenue $588,366 · expenses $611,279 · reserve months 69.6
Tax year 2011 — took in $355,295 more than it spent. Revenue $1,068,716 · expenses $713,421 · reserve months 60.0
